WebSep 3, 2024 · You hold one chopstick in your dominant hand between your pointer, middle finger, and thumb, and when you move it up and down, your thumb should be stationary. You can practice with a single chopstick to get this right. The other chopstick goes between your thumb and your palm, rests on your ring finger, and stays still.

WebMar 2, 2024 · Chinese Chopsticks. The difference between Chinese chopsticks from Korean or Japanese is that they are usually longer and thicker. The length is usually 25cm with blunt, wide, or flat tips. WebMar 7, 2024 · Keep the thick end of the chopstick about 1 to 2 inches (2.5 to 5.1 cm) from your fingers. [2] If your chopsticks are crossed, you need to readjust how you're holding them. 3. Move the top chopstick and keep the bottom one stationary. Move your middle finger up and down to maneuver your chopsticks.
